Runbook: Driver Assignment Heuristic (Fleetwise Dispatch)

When a shift opens, the heuristic scores each available driver by proximity, recent load, and vehicle class. Never override scores manually without flagging the shift in the audit table. To inspect scoring inputs, query the assignment snapshot database directly using the connection string below.

replica DSN, yahog-kawig: redis://istox_svc:um@db-8a67.halixforge.test:5432/frawyn

Handing over the Ledgerpine payments integration suite. Three tests in the refund flow fail intermittently — looks like the sandbox gateway returns stale idempotency keys under load. Retries mask it locally but plugin authors will hit it in CI. Quarantine list is in the repo root; don't add more without a linked ticket. For unresolved flakes, escalate to the person named below.

named custodian: Brivan Eliath Quenox Frador

Handover — Findery relevance tuning

Hey, passing the Findery search relevance work to you. Short version: we weight recency hard for news-type queries and barely at all for docs, and the synonym expander is deliberately conservative after the "maple/staple" incident. The tuning notes live in the Lanternwood wiki under Relevance Experiments — read the failed ones first, they're more useful. For new team members poking at ranking locally, the scorer picks up its weights from config, currently set as follows.

config for yajep-tafof:
[rusath]
team = julmir
access_code = ac_fe37fd
host = rusath.novactech.test
port = 8000
owner = pelmir.weneth
peer = oliwyn.olvarqdyn.internal

CI NOTE — Ledgerline schema registry

Symptom: registry compatibility checks fail intermittently on the Brindle runners. Cause: the check job races the registry warm-up; first poll returns an empty subject list and the gate treats it as a breaking change. Fix applied: retry with backoff, fail only after three consistent mismatches. Do not "fix" by skipping the gate — that let an incompatible event schema ship once already. If it recurs, capture the runner logs before re-queueing. The last known-good pipeline build is recorded below.

pipeline stamp: htk3_69f